Speaker Bio

Suzy Salamy works as a social worker both locally and nationally with Innocence Network member organizations, helping clients in their transition to life outside prison after wrongful incarceration. Previously, Suzy worked at the New York City Anti-Violence Project as the senior manager of the clinical and advocacy programs, providing crisis intervention, counseling, and advocacy to LGBTQ and HIV-affected survivors of violence. She received her BA from Bard College and Master of Social Work from the Silberman School of Social Work at Hunter College.
